British Airways launches Trade Graduate Programme for travel trade partners

British Airways has launched the Trade Graduate Programme, an initiative aimed at recognising, motivating and rewarding travel agents. The Trade Graduate Programme will equip the airline’s trade partners with product knowledge and network information with respect to British Airways. The trade partners enrolled under the programme will be encouraged to complete nine incentivised training modules. Participants will get 15 days to complete each module.

Moran Birger, regional general manager, South Asia, British Airways, said, “We at British Airways value the relationship we share with our trusted travel trade partners as they play an instrumental role in providing excellent service to our customers in India. We have invested heavily in facilities including a call centre that provides round the clock assistance in order to build a long standing association with our trade partners. The Trade Graduate Programme is an extension of our efforts in supporting our partners in their endeavour to serve our customers better.”

With five winners per module, the programme is offering 45 travel trade partners the opportunity to win shopping vouchers. Additionally, participants who complete four, seven and all nine modules also get a chance to win shopping gift vouchers worth INR 5,000 to INR 20,000. The first module is on World Traveller Plus, British Airways’ premium economy product and will be available till September 30, 2016. New modules will be available every fortnight and participants will be notified through the Speedbird Club Newsletter. Names of the winners of previous modules will also be published in the newsletter.

The airline currently operates 49 flights a week from five key cities in India, including New Delhi, Mumbai, Chennai, Bengaluru and Hyderabad.
